Outline of Final Research Achievements

In order to advance the cell therapy for cardiac arrhythmia, massive amount of iPS Cells-derived cardiomyocytes are necessary. Therefor the massive suspension culture system with a spinner flask and efficient purification strategy of cardiomyocytes were invented. Artificial nucleases were used to insert the fluorescent proteins into the specific locus of cardiac-specific transcription factor (NKX2-5) and conduction system specific gene. These cell lines were specifically differentiated and analyzed. Purified cardiomyocytes were transplanted into pigs and the transplantation strategy was evaluated. Cardiac telemetry transmitters were also implanted into pigs and the evaluation system of arrhythmia was established.
